Almost £2000 was raised for Highland Hospice at a fundraising bingo night at Café V8 in Inverness.

The event was organised by Donna Fraser, one of nine finalists in this year’s Ness Factor singing competition.

Miss Fraser (35), from Balloch, said the evening raised £1987 in total and added: “It was a great night of prize bingo and raffles, and finished off with music from The Travelling Wrinklies.

Miss Fraser’s next fundraiser will be a local hoolie with a night of live music and possibly another raffle on Saturday, October 29.

A hospice spokesman said: “Huge congratulations to Ness Factor finalist Donna Fraser who managed to raise an incredible £1987 at her bingo night at Café V8 on Saturday, September 17.
